const frontmatterFormats = exports.frontmatterFormats = ['yaml-frontmatter', 'toml-frontmatter', 'json-frontmatter'];
const formatExtensions = exports.formatExtensions = {
yml: 'yml',
yaml: 'yml',
toml: 'toml',
json: 'json',
frontmatter: 'md',
'json-frontmatter': 'md',
'toml-frontmatter': 'md',
'yaml-frontmatter': 'md'
};
function getFormatExtensions() {
return _objectSpread(_objectSpread({}, formatExtensions), (0, _registry.getCustomFormatsExtensions)());
}
const extensionFormatters = exports.extensionFormatters = {
yml: _yaml.default,
yaml: _yaml.default,
toml: _toml.default,
json: _json.default,
md: _frontmatter.FrontmatterInfer,
markdown: _frontmatter.FrontmatterInfer,
html: _frontmatter.FrontmatterInfer
};
function formatByName(name, customDelimiter) {
const formatters = _objectSpread({
yml: _yaml.default,
yaml: _yaml.default,
toml: _toml.default,
json: _json.default,
frontmatter: _frontmatter.FrontmatterInfer,
'json-frontmatter': (0, _frontmatter.frontmatterJSON)(customDelimiter),
'toml-frontmatter': (0, _frontmatter.frontmatterTOML)(customDelimiter),
'yaml-frontmatter': (0, _frontmatter.frontmatterYAML)(customDelimiter)
}, (0, _registry.getCustomFormatsFormatters)());
if (name in formatters) {
return formatters[name];
}
throw new Error(`No formatter available with name: ${name}`);
}
function frontmatterDelimiterIsList(frontmatterDelimiter) {
return _immutable.List.isList(frontmatterDelimiter);
}
function resolveFormat(collection, entry) {
// Check for custom delimiter
const frontmatter_delimiter = collection.get('frontmatter_delimiter');
const customDelimiter = frontmatterDelimiterIsList(frontmatter_delimiter) ? frontmatter_delimiter.toArray() : frontmatter_delimiter;
// If the format is specified in the collection, use that format.
const formatSpecification = collection.get('format');
if (formatSpecification) {
return formatByName(formatSpecification, customDelimiter);
}
// If a file already exists, infer the format from its file extension.
const filePath = entry && entry.path;
if (filePath) {
const fileExtension = filePath.split('.').pop();
if (fileExtension) {
return (0, _get2.default)(extensionFormatters, fileExtension);
}
}
// If creating a new file, and an `extension` is specified in the
// collection config, infer the format from that extension.
const extension = collection.get('extension');
if (extension) {
return (0, _get2.default)(extensionFormatters, extension);
}
// If no format is specified and it cannot be inferred, return the default.
return formatByName('frontmatter', customDelimiter);
}
